python爬虫和百度哪个好用

不及物动词 其他 177

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    一、内容要开门见山的回答问题,不要有引言,首先,其次,然后等词。2、内容结构清晰,要有小标题。文章字数要大于3000字;不需要显示标题;

    百度是中国最大的搜索引擎之一,而Python爬虫是一种编程技术,用于从网页上获取信息。两者在不同的领域有着不同的应用和优势。

    一、百度的优势
    1.广泛的信息覆盖:百度拥有庞大的网页索引库,可以搜索到各种各样的信息,包括文档、图片、视频等。
    2.智能搜索算法:百度通过不断优化搜索算法,可以根据用户的搜索关键词和意图,提供更准确、相关的搜索结果。
    3.丰富的搜索功能:百度提供了丰富的搜索功能,如地图搜索、音乐搜索、网页翻译等,方便用户进行多样化的信息搜索。

    二、Python爬虫的优势
    1.高效的数据获取:Python爬虫可以自动化地从网页上获取信息,并将其存储到本地或者数据库中,有效地解决了手动复制粘贴的繁琐过程。
    2.灵活的数据处理:Python爬虫可以对获取到的数据进行灵活的处理和分析,如提取关键信息、进行数据清洗和转换等,满足不同需求的数据处理要求。
    3.定制化的功能实现:Python爬虫可以根据需求定制各种功能,如定时定点爬取、登录验证、验证码识别等,提供更多的扩展功能。

    三、百度和Python爬虫的应用场景
    1.百度的应用场景:
    (1)信息查询:用户可以通过百度搜索各种信息,如新闻、教育、娱乐等;
    (2)导航查询:百度地图可以帮助用户找到目的地,并提供实时路况信息;
    (3)购物搜索:百度购物可以帮助用户搜索和比较不同商品的价格和品牌;
    (4)音乐视听:用户可以通过百度音乐搜索并播放自己喜欢的音乐。

    2.Python爬虫的应用场景:
    (1)数据采集:企业可以利用Python爬虫从网络中采集各种数据,如商品价格、竞争对手信息等,进行市场调研和分析;
    (2)舆情监控:政府和企业可以使用Python爬虫对网络舆情进行监控和分析,及时了解公众对某一事件或产品的态度和评价;
    (3)网站更新检测:网站管理员可以使用Python爬虫定期检测网站更新情况,及时发现并修复漏洞和问题;
    (4)数据分析:研究人员可以使用Python爬虫获取需要的数据,并进行数据分析和建模。

    四、结论
    百度和Python爬虫都是非常有用的工具,在不同的应用场景下发挥着重要作用。如果你只是需要搜索和获取信息,那么使用百度是不错的选择;如果你需要大规模、定制化的信息采集和处理,那么使用Python爬虫是更好的选择。最终,根据具体需求来选择使用哪种工具,可以更好地满足需求,提高工作效率。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    爬虫和百度是两种完全不同的工具和技术,分别用于不同的目的和领域。没有绝对的优劣之分,只能根据具体需求和情境来选择使用哪种工具。

    1. 功能和用途:
    – 爬虫:爬虫是用来自动化获取网页上的信息的工具。它能够抓取网页内容、解析数据、提取有用信息等。一般用于数据采集、数据分析、搜索引擎等领域。
    – 百度:百度是一个网络搜索引擎,其目的是帮助用户在互联网上找到他们想要的信息。百度通过爬虫将网络上的页面进行索引,用户可以通过输入关键词来搜索相关信息。

    2. 自由度和灵活度:
    – 爬虫:爬虫是一种程序化的工具,可以根据需求自定义其行为。用户可以自己编写脚本,指定抓取网站的规则、提取想要的数据,并根据需要进行数据处理和转换。
    – 百度:百度是一个搜索引擎,其抓取和索引的规则由百度自己决定。用户只能通过输入关键词来搜索相关信息,无法自定义抓取和提取的规则。

    3. 数据获取:
    – 爬虫:爬虫可以抓取任何公开可访问的网页上的信息,包括普通网页、论坛、社交媒体、新闻网站等。用户可以根据需求自由选择目标网站,并根据页面结构提取数据。
    – 百度:百度只能搜索自己已经抓取过的网页上的信息,用户无法直接获取未经百度索引的网页内容。而且百度的搜索结果也受到百度排名算法的影响,不同用户搜索同一个关键词可能得到不同的结果。

    4. 数据规模和实时性:
    – 爬虫:爬虫可以批量抓取大量的网页,从而获取大规模的数据。用户可以通过调整抓取速度和并发处理的数量来提高抓取效率。并且可以实时监控目标网站的变化,随时抓取最新数据。
    – 百度:百度搜索的数据量非常庞大,用户可以通过输入关键词来获取海量的搜索结果。但是用户无法实时监控和抓取最新数据,搜索结果可能会有一定的延迟。

    5. 隐私和法律合规:
    – 爬虫:爬虫可以根据用户自定义的规则抓取网页上的信息,但是在进行数据采集时需要考虑隐私和法律合规问题。爬虫开发者需要确保自己的爬虫行为不违反相关法律法规,并尊重网站的使用规则和隐私政策。
    – 百度:百度作为一个搜索引擎,其索引的网页内容是公开可访问的,用户的搜索行为和搜索结果也会被记录。用户需要自行保护好自己的个人隐私,并明确百度的隐私政策。

    综上所述,爬虫和百度都是有各自的优势和适用场景的工具。如果需要大规模、实时、自定义的数据采集和处理,可以选择使用爬虫;如果需要快速搜索互联网上的信息,可以使用百度。根据具体需要和情境,灵活选择使用。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    1、方法方面:

    Python爬虫:
    Python爬虫是通过编写Python脚本来自动获取互联网上的数据。Python拥有丰富的库和模块,如BeautifulSoup、Scrapy等,可以大大简化爬虫的开发过程。同时,Python也支持多线程和异步编程,可以提高爬取效率。

    百度爬虫:
    百度爬虫是百度公司提供的搜索引擎爬虫,通过爬取网页内容来建立搜索引擎索引。百度爬虫具有强大的抓取能力和智能解析能力,可以处理各种类型的网页,如静态网页、动态网页和JavaScript渲染的网页。

    2、操作流程方面:

    Python爬虫:
    1. 寻找目标网站:确定需要爬取的网站,并了解该网站的结构和数据格式。
    2. 分析网页结构:使用开发者工具或相关工具查看网页源码,找出需要抓取的数据所在的位置和标签。
    3. 编写爬虫脚本:使用Python编写爬虫代码,利用相应的库和模块解析网页并提取所需数据。
    4. 定义数据存储方式:将爬取到的数据存储到数据库、文本文件或Excel等介质中,方便后续处理和分析。
    5. 运行爬虫脚本:在命令行或开发环境中运行编写好的爬虫脚本,并观察结果是否符合预期。

    百度爬虫:
    1. 提交网站:将需要被百度爬取的网站提交给百度搜索引擎。
    2. 网站抓取:百度爬虫会定期抓取网站上的内容,并将抓取到的网页保存到百度的服务器上。
    3. 网页解析:百度爬虫对抓取到的网页进行解析,提取出页面标题、关键词、描述等元信息,并建立页面与关键词的映射关系。
    4. 网页索引:将解析完的网页内容和元信息存入百度的索引库中,方便用户搜索时能够快速找到相关内容。
    5. 网页排名:根据网页的质量和相关性,百度搜索引擎会对网页进行排名,以便用户获取更符合需求的搜索结果。

    综上所述,Python爬虫和百度爬虫在方法和操作流程方面有所差异。Python爬虫更适用于个性化需求,可以根据自己的需求定制爬取规则和数据处理方式;而百度爬虫主要为了建立搜索引擎索引,需求相对固定。因此,在个性化需求较多的情况下,使用Python爬虫更为灵活方便,而在需要进行网页搜索和排名的情况下,使用百度爬虫更为适合。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部